The speech therapist evaluates and treats patients with speech, language, hearing, and oral motor disorders. They function as an interdisciplinary team member to provide direct patient care and individualized care planning.
Position evaluates patients regarding the application of a wide variety of therapeutic techniques for rehab of speech, language, hearing and oral motor disorders. Functions as an interdisciplinary team member providing patient assessment/re assessment, direct patient care, and individualized care planning/implementation. Provides quality speech therapy services according to the principles and practices of speech therapy.
Assess patient needs for speech therapy in a timely fashion; completes initial evaluation in accordance with the policies and procedures of the department. Documents patient care efficiently and effectively Develops and maintains long and short-term treatment goals that are functional and measurable for each patient. Re-evaluates and modifies treatment programs as warranted. Instructs patients, families, nurses and other caregivers in appropriate diet consistencies, swallowing strategies, cognitive strategies and communications techniques. Integrates information, prioritizes needs, involves patient/family in planning process. Utilizes the most appropriate form of treatment provided with the highest level of care. Other related job tasks or responsibilities as assigned
Special Skills: Excellent customer service skills. Strong interpersonal skills to interact positively and effectively with patients, families and physicians. Minimum Requirements: Education: Master's Degree from an Accredited Program in Speech Language Pathology.
Abrazo West Campus is recognized for providing exceptional, comprehensive care to patients in West Valley communities. The 200-bed acute care hospital offers advanced services, including the da Vinci Xi surgical platform, Level I Trauma Center, Loop-X system, orthopedics, obstetrics and cardiovascular care.
Candidates must hold a Master's degree in Speech Language Pathology from an accredited program and possess current Arizona licensure. One year of clinical experience, including acute care modified swallow experience, is required.
